FlashZap is the dedicated bootloader mode used by Motorola Solutions for its high-end two-way radios. When a radio enters this mode, it is prepared to receive new firmware, configuration data, or recovery files.

Firmware Updates: Easily push the latest performance enhancements to your fleet.

Device Recovery: A lifesaver for "bricked" radios stuck in boot loops or showing firmware errors.

Understanding Motorola FlashZap: Features, Drivers, and Best Practices

is a specialized bootloader mode and driver set used primarily for the

series of two-way radios. It serves as the bridge between a PC and the radio hardware, allowing for critical operations like firmware updates, device recovery from a "bricked" state, and system configuration. Core Functionality

FlashZap is not a standard programming mode; it is a "bootstrap" state designed for deep-level communication with the radio’s processor. Firmware Management

: Enables the flashing of new firmware to add features or fix bugs. Device Recovery

: Used to rescue radios that are stuck in boot loops or show "invalid firmware" errors. System Enumeration

: When a radio is in FlashZap mode, it appears in the Windows Device Manager as a "Motorola FlashZap Device". Essential Drivers and Software Performance: It bypasses many of the verification loops

To interact with a radio in this mode, specific software components are required: MOTOTRBO FlashZap Driver

: A Windows USB driver that enables stable data transfer during critical update processes. Customer Programming Software (CPS)

: The primary tool used alongside the FlashZap driver to perform the actual firmware "FLASHing". Depot Tools

: More advanced, factory-level software often used in conjunction with FlashZap for deep recovery or feature unlocking, though these are typically restricted to authorized service centers. Best Practices for "Best" Performance
